Shock as 2 year old contracts herpes (photos)

Two year old Kalo Hoy, spent four days in hospital last month after his parents, Lorna Hoy, 27, and Andy Briggs, 34, noticed small red spots forming across his face, chest and arm.

After being dismissed twice by doctors, Lorna claims it wasn’t until their third attempt to seek medical advice their concerns were taken seriously.

Kalo tested positive for the herpes simplex virus – something doctors suggest he caught after being kissed by infected adult.

Lorna, from Salford, Manchester said: “I never thought this would happen to our family.

“Kalo had red spots all over this face, chest and arm before he was diagnosed with herpes.

“He had ulcers in his mouth and needed injections in his eyes to ensure the infection hadn’t spread to them as this could’ve blinded him.

“I have heard of babies dying from catching this virus which is awful and I think the only reason Kalo survived is because he was just under two at time.

“I hope our story serves as a warning to other parents as it could happen to anyone.
